Two_Hangmen@midwest.socialto Ask Lemmy@lemmy.world•How many of you microwave water for tea?1·1 month agoIf you’re using distilled water there’s not enough minerals in the water to start the boiling process before the temperature crosses 100 C because microwaves heat it up so fast.
It also doesn’t necessarily have to be distilled water, but the the closer it is to just H2O, the higher the chance this will happen.
